Understanding Circuit Breaker Trip Testers Ensuring Safety and Reliability


In the realm of electrical engineering and safety management, circuit breakers play a pivotal role in protecting electrical circuits from overloads and faults. When these systems trip, their functionality must be tested to ensure they react appropriately in real-world scenarios. This is where circuit breaker trip testers come into play. These devices are essential for verifying the operational integrity of circuit breakers, thereby guaranteeing that they will perform as expected during a fault situation.


What is a Circuit Breaker Trip Tester?


A circuit breaker trip tester is a specialized instrument designed to simulate overcurrent conditions, providing a controlled environment to observe how a circuit breaker responds. By introducing a test current that exceeds the circuit breaker’s rated capacity, engineers and electricians can assess whether the breaker trips within the specified time and current thresholds. Trip testers can vary in complexity, from simple handheld devices to advanced computerized systems that offer detailed analytics and reporting capabilities.


Importance of Testing Circuit Breakers


The significance of circuit breaker testing cannot be overstated. Circuit breakers are often the first line of defense against electrical faults, such as short circuits or overloads, which can lead to equipment damage, fires, or even serious injuries. Regular testing ensures that these critical components are in good working condition. Here are several key reasons why testing is essential


1. Preventing Electrical Fires Faulty circuit breakers may fail to trip during an overcurrent scenario, potentially causing overheating and electrical fires. Regular testing helps identify wear or malfunction, reducing the risk of such hazardous situations.


2. Compliance with Safety Standards Various regulations and standards stipulate that electrical systems be maintained to certain safety criteria. Testing circuit breakers helps facilities comply with these regulations, avoiding potential fines and enhancing overall safety.


3. Operational Reliability In industrial and commercial settings, equipment downtime can be costly. By ensuring circuit breakers function correctly, organizations can enhance the reliability of their electrical systems and minimize disruptions.


4. Equipment Longevity Over time, circuit breakers can degrade due to environmental factors, electrical surges, or physical wear. Regular testing allows for the early detection of issues, prolonging the life of the equipment.

How Circuit Breaker Trip Testers Work


Circuit breaker trip testers work by applying a specified test current to the circuit breaker to evaluate its responsiveness. The process typically involves the following steps


1. Setup The tester is connected to the circuit breaker, ensuring that all safety protocols are followed to prevent any electrical hazards during testing.


2. Configuration The operator configures the tester to apply the appropriate settings based on the circuit breaker’s specifications, such as rated current and trip characteristics.


3. Testing The tester applies the test current, and the operator monitors the circuit breaker’s response. This can be performed under various conditions, such as instantaneous or timed trip settings.


4. Data Analysis After the test, the data is analyzed to determine whether the circuit breaker tripped correctly within the expected parameters. Advanced testers may provide detailed reports that include trip times, current levels, and operational diagnostics.
